Hi
how do I import contacts that don't have the same email domain as the company that I want to associate them with? Is there another way of linking them together in the import process?
The email/domain association setting when importing ignores contacts with freemail email addresses (gmail.com, outlook.com, etc). In these cases, HubSpot will also look at the Contact property "Website URL" to see if we can match that property value to the Company Domain Name on the company record. If the contact is not using a freemail email address, but their email address is also not the same as the company, the contacts would have to be manually associated to the correct company.

"UPDATE: - it is possible to associate the contact object to a company object when you do the import. In fact, you can associate any 2 object types (contact, company, deal, ticket, note) using a common identifier. You have to structure the data correctly in the import file and use the multiple objects and associations functionality. Hubspot's import tool has been greatly improved.
